Sarah Louisa Hawes was born in 1867 in Uny Lelant, Cornwall, England, the child of William Francis Hawes And Sarah Drew Peters. Sarah Louisa Hawes married William Rowe Harry, and had children including Eveline Harry, Gordon William Harry, Myrtle Louisa Harry, Olive Sarah Harry. Sarah Louisa Hawes passed away in 1952 in Dayton, OH.
